mapState, mapGetters, mapActions
时间: 2023-11-22 08:40:26 浏览: 79
vuex中的 mapState,mapGetters,mapActions,mapMutations 的使用
mapState、mapGetters和mapActions是Vue.js的Vuex库中的辅助函数,用于简化在组件中使用状态、计算属性和操作的过程。
mapState函数将Vuex中的状态映射到组件的计算属性中,使得可以通过this访问Vuex中的状态。这样可以方便地在组件中获取和使用Vuex中的数据。
mapGetters函数将Vuex中的计算属性映射到组件的计算属性中,使得可以通过this访问Vuex中的计算属性。这样可以方便地在组件中获取和使用Vuex中的计算属性的返回值。
mapActions函数将Vuex中的操作映射到组件的方法中,使得可以通过this调用Vuex中的操作。这样可以方便地在组件中触发Vuex中的操作,更新Vuex中的状态。
通过使用这些辅助函数,可以简化组件中对Vuex的引用和使用,使得代码更加简洁和易于维护。
阅读全文